Baltimore Technologies shares sunk 16 per cent this morning after the company snubbed a bid approach by Chantilley Corporation.

Baltimore said the proposed all-paper deal would not add any value. It said Chantilley, a small unlisted British firm, had made no firm offer for the company, that it had declined to meet Chantilley and did not plan to hold any further talks.

Baltimore's shares have plunged over 90 per cent since early last year, and some investors are eager for a buyer to rescue them from the share register.

In early morning action, the stock was down 14.7 per cent, or 5p, at 29p.
